1. Rajasthani Stone Chakki (Flour Grinder)
A staple in traditional Indian kitchens, the stone chakki was used to grind grains into flour.
- History: The use of chakkis dates back centuries, when every household relied on fresh, hand-ground flour.
- Legacy: Its rhythmic grinding sound was synonymous with mornings in Indian homes.

2. Brass Spice Boxes
Known as “masala dabbas,” these brass containers were indispensable for organizing spices.
- History: Every Indian kitchen had a spice box that was often passed down generations.
- Legacy: Each box tells the story of the rich and aromatic spices that define Indian cuisine.

3. Wooden Dough Makers
Handcrafted wooden bowls were traditionally used for kneading dough.
- History: These bowls simplified the preparation of staples like roti and paratha.
- Legacy: They reflect the resourcefulness and skill of rural artisans.

4. Traditional Stone Mortar and Pestle
Used for grinding spices and herbs, this tool is an emblem of old-world cooking.
- History: Mortar and pestle sets have been used for millennia, allowing cooks to extract maximum flavor.
- Legacy: Each tool was crafted from locally sourced stone, ensuring durability and uniqueness.

5. Copper and Brass Utensils
Cooking and serving in copper and brass utensils were common in Indian households.
- History: These materials were chosen not just for their durability but also for their health benefits.
- Legacy: Each utensil was intricately designed, doubling as functional art.
